Laser Peels
Laser peels are advanced skin resurfacing treatments that use focused laser energy to exfoliate damaged outer layers of skin and stimulate collagen production beneath. This minimally invasive procedure improves skin texture, tone, and clarity by removing dead skin cells, reducing pigmentation, and smoothing fine lines. Ideal for treating sun damage, acne scars, uneven pigmentation, and signs of aging, laser peels promote healthier, rejuvenated skin with controlled downtime.

How Long Does It Last?
Results from laser peels typically last several months, depending on the intensity of treatment and ongoing skin care. Many patients choose to have periodic maintenance treatments every 3 to 6 months to sustain optimal skin health and appearance. Visible improvements often appear within 1 to 2 weeks, with continued skin renewal over subsequent months.

Aftercare FAQ
Laser peels address fine lines, wrinkles, acne scars, sun damage, pigmentation issues, uneven texture, and enlarged pores.
Typically, 1 to 3 sessions spaced 4 to 6 weeks apart deliver optimal improvement, but the exact number depends on your skin condition and goals.
Most patients feel mild warmth or tingling during the procedure. Numbing creams and cooling devices are used to ensure comfort.
Downtime varies by peel intensity but usually involves redness and mild peeling for 3 to 7 days. Recovery instructions help minimize discomfort.
Yes, there are specialized laser settings and peel depths designed to safely treat darker skin types while minimizing pigmentation risks.
Avoid sun exposure and tanning for at least 2 weeks before treatment, and discontinue any retinoids or exfoliating products as advised by your provider.
